We are looking for something new project where we could practice our skills.

1. ThePirateBay.com top 200 text parser

Main area would be movies, but later could add games, music and so on.
  • takes the list parses from internet(could be done both web or desktop app
  • sort the list, remove duplicates, remove unwanted text, keeps only the name
  • uses some other web to get the information about the movie example IMDB
  • adds the information to app, save it to xml or use database
